Output e33b52b9511337fac2490679779ce7423f2bee847eaa18007320c6c9a518c7ac:1

value
96608527
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4aff3ed1369353acd9473329a24f878af69f083f OP_EQUALVERIFY OP_CHECKSIG
address
17qYmxQowfUffdHqgYGfw9tUMPxswqupGR
transaction
e33b52b9511337fac2490679779ce7423f2bee847eaa18007320c6c9a518c7ac
spent
true